Non-Home Ownership. The FHA allows you to be considered a first-time homebuyer, even if you’ve owned a primary residence within three years of your purchase, if your primary residence has not been permanently attached to anything, like a foundation. This means that if you have been living in a mobile home or RV, you should qualify as a first-time homebuyer.

5 First Time Home Buyer Programs In the Peach State, first-time home buyers – considered to be buyers who haven’t owned a home in three years – can look to the Georgia Dream Home Ownership Program for help finding mortgage financing. The home loan rates and fees are set by the Georgia Department of Community Affairs. National first-time home buyer programs.

The First-time Home Buyers’ Tax Credit exists to assist first-time home buyers with the costs associated with the purchase of a home, such as legal fees, disbursements and land transfer taxes. The HBTC is a $5,000 non-refundable income tax credit amount on a qualifying home acquired after January 27, 2009.

For mortgage programs, the definition of a first-time home buyer is usually altered to mean someone who hasn’t owned a home in the past three years. Special first-time buyer mortgage programs offer preferred terms to such buyers.

First-time homebuyer status makes it easier to get your foot in the door through low down payments and grants. A first-time homebuyer has not owned a home in the past three years. You generally can’t buy a home under first-time status if your wife is currently a homeowner, with a few exceptions.
